This course page examines the role of music in psychedelic healing across historical and modern contexts. It discusses indigenous ceremonial use, the development of psychedelic therapy in the 20th century, and the views of early researchers and practitioners on music’s ability to support altered states and emotional processing. The content also explores how music’s pace, rhythm, and style can influence the flow of a session and the therapeutic trajectory of psychedelic-assisted therapy. It draws on research insights and expert commentary to explain why music is considered an important nonverbal tool in guided psychedelic experiences.
